Neuropatía isquémica monomiélica asociada al implante de fístula arteriovenosa. Reporte de caso
La neuropatía isquémica monomiélica (NIM) es una complicación rara, con incidencia entre el 1 y el 3%. Se caracteriza por disfunción de troncos neurales periféricos secundaria a la implantación de una fístula arteriovenosa (FAV). Un acceso vascular funcionante es fundamental para los pacientes en hemodiálisis, pero mantener este permeable, es un reto. Existen varias técnicas para conseguirlo, las más utilizadas son la colocación de un catéter venoso central y la creación de una fístula arteriovenosa.

Antecedentes: El cilostazol tiene efectos sobre el endotelio vascular que podrían favorecer la maduración de la fístula arteriovenosa al inhibir la agregación plaquetaria, producir vasodilatación y reducir la proliferación vascular. Objetivo: Evaluar la relación entre el uso de cilostazol y la maduración de fístulas arteriovenosas.
